Output d508d0e386f3c2a866d9ae35ee618a1d8bbe1fbad23635d0ca92accb520314ed:0

value
289615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1c0535504420b8c6b3d33efd0716e195ee54cb OP_EQUAL
address
35tpaFnDckLYD51PwxvSrDsnqbV89BB2M6
transaction
d508d0e386f3c2a866d9ae35ee618a1d8bbe1fbad23635d0ca92accb520314ed
confirmations
167760
spent
true